3.75 – 6.5Watt Proton Rad Hard 100K+® DC – DC Converters

Features

RadHard TID >100kRad(Si)
2:1 Margin: Operates beyond 200kRad TID
No SEE: LET > 82meV*cm^2/mg
Proton Resistant: No optocouplers used
Specifically designed for redundant space applications
Completely self contained Thick Film Hybrid DC-DC Converter
No External Filter Caps required
Fully Isolated design
Inhibit-not function
200kHz operation for low ripple and fast response time
Built in EMI input filter meets MIL-STD 461C requirements CE01,CE03, CS01, CS02 & CS06
Short Circuit protection
Over voltage protection
BIT

Specifications

Input: 28 VDC
Input Range (Continuous): 16 VDC to 50 VDC
Input Range (Full Power): 18 VDC to 50 VDC
Transient Survival Voltage: 80 VDC
Isolation Input to Case: 500 VDC
Isolation Input to Output: 500 VDC
Isolation Output to Case: 100 VDC
Storage Temp: -55 °C to 150 °C
Shock: 50 G's
Acceleration: 500 G's
Vibration: 30 G's
Weight: 50 gms typical
